About me and my therapy practice

Sometimes, life feels overwhelming and we can struggle to cope with stress, anxiety, or sadness on our own. Receiving proper support can illuminate difficult times, much like a light brightens the dark. I understand, finding the right counsellor is personal, and it's important to feel heard, understood, and safe.

As a professional, person-centred/humanistic counsellor, I offer a safe, confidential, and non-judgemental space where clients can explore their thoughts and feelings openly, and at their own pace.

I support clients dealing with anxiety, stress, low mood, trauma, bereavement, and loss. Additionally, I have significant experience working with neurodiverse individuals. I am trained in mindful and somatic practices that help calm the nervous system and support therapeutic work. As well as my work with adults, I have a significant amount of experience working with children and adolescents (aged 10-18yrs). I specialise in young people's counselling, particularly additional needs. 

I have worked across multiple settings, such as specialist counselling services, multi-disciplinary teams and education environments, as well as private practice. In my practice I have supported clients of all ages with various mental health difficulties and emotional distress. 


Practice description

My practice is rooted in humanistic, or person centred, counselling, which places your experiences and perspective at the heart of the therapeutic process. In addition to this I utilise aspects of other therapeutic modalities to enhance the work we do together, tailoring the therapy to meet your individual needs. 

Where appropriate, I offer creative and somatic therapy practices, alongside mindfulness-based interventions such as grounding, body scans and breathwork. This holistic approach helps clients navigate their feelings and challenges in a way that honours their whole self — mind, body, and spirit.

My therapeutic work with children and young people is grounded in creative, play-based opportunities that foster self-discovery and expression, allowing them to explore their inner lives in a manner that feels natural and engaging. Alongside this, I incorporate psychoeducation to help demystify emotions and behaviours, empowering young clients with knowledge and tools for resilience. By nurturing strong, trusting therapeutic relationships, I provide a foundation of safety and acceptance, ensuring each child or adolescent feels seen, heard, and supported throughout their journey.

I offer both long and short term one-to-one sessions via face-to-face or online therapy.
